All,

The following instructions pertain to the passing of SB 244 regarding gender reclassifications. I've attached the letter that was sent to the individuals who need to return to our office and have their credential updated with their gender at birth. A flag will show on record indicating SB244 NOTICE for anyone who has been sent a letter. The individuals will be charged as normal for their reissuance.

Should these customers arrive at the office without an appointment you are to make certain to get them processed as soon as possible, getting them in and out of the office.

When issuing these credentials, you MUST reach out to the DL Helpdesk at KDOR_Photostop@ks.gov with the individuals K# and name indicating SB 244 update.

For your ISSUANCE NOTE please include the following information:
ο»Ώο»Ώ"Subject"=REISSUED PER SB 244
ο»Ώο»Ώ"Note"=GENDER CHANGED FROM MALE TO FEMALE (or whatever the situation) - Along with regular credential issuance notes

There’s a reason privacy advocates are fond of Sen. Ron Wyden, and its not just because he routinely champions legislation aimed at protecting civil liberties. From his perch on the Senate Select Committee on Intelligence, Wyden is uniquely well situated to spot intelligence programs that strain the limits of the law or unduly encroach on Americans’ privacy.  And while Wyden takes his obligation not to reveal classified information seriously, he has a history of doing all he can to draw public attention to those potential problem areas.  Long before Edward Snowden revealed the NSA’s now-defunct mass database of domestic telephone records, Wyden was sounding the alarm about a secret and radical interpretation of the Patriot Act’s β€œbusiness records” provision.  Most notoriously, at a public hearing in 2013, he pressed then–Director of National Intelligence James Clapper on whether NSA collected any type of data on Americans in bulkβ€”and received the now-infamous answer β€œnot wittingly,”  which seriously weakened Clapper’s credibility when it was revealed to be false just a few months later.
